Lesson Module 2 - Physics
Physics
This module is a condensed Introduction to Physics . Physics is the study of matter and its properties as well the motion of matter and the cause of its motion. The major components of Physics are Mechanics, Heat, Sound, Electricity and Magnetism, Optics, and Atomic structure. We will focus on the basics of Mechanics .

There will be a video demonstration at the start of each daily lesson. Each lesson will start with a short video lecture or a simulated lab exercise. Most days will have a brief assignment related to the video or lab simulation followed by an “Around the House” assignment in which each student will have an opportunity to do an activity involving items that can be found around the house.

Meet the Instructor
Hi, my name is Timothy Holland . I have been teaching Math, Chemistry, and Physics for 27 years. I am currently in my 9th year teaching at Cedar Ridge High School in Round Rock. I teach AP Physics 1 and AP Physics C; also as part of the Cedar Ridge Engineering Academy, I teach Digital Electronics. This is my 12th year working with AUSPREP, for which I will be teaching Physics.

I really enjoy teaching Physics. To motivate students, I teach with energy and incorporate demonstrations into the lessons to make them more fun and interesting. My best moments in the classroom are hearing students respond to understanding a concept and seeing the look on their faces during a demonstration. My purpose is to continue to find ways to make teaching Physics easier and fun to learn.

Austin Pre-Freshman Engineering Program (AusPREP) at Huston-Tillotson University is one of the Texas Pre-Freshman Engineering Programs (TexPREP) located on college campuses in Texas. PREP was founded to identify high achieving middle and high school students with the potential and interest in becoming scientists and engineers and to reinforce them in the pursuit of these fields.
